Types of Car Key Services Offered by Locksmiths

  1. Car Lockout Assistance

    • If you've locked yourself out of your car, a locksmith can open your vehicle without causing damage to the locks or the vehicle itself.
    • They can utilize a range of methods, including lock picking, to get.
  2. Key Duplication

    • If you require a spare key, a locksmith can duplicate your existing key rapidly and effectively.
    • They can likewise replicate keys for older vehicles that utilize easier mechanical locks.
  3. Key Fob Programming

    • Modern car keys often include electronic components like key fobs.
    • A locksmith can program a brand-new key fob or reprogram an existing one to deal with your car.
  4. Ignition Key Replacement

    • If your ignition key is broken or worn, a locksmith can replace it with a brand-new one.
    • They can likewise deal with more complex ignition systems, such as those with transponder keys.
  5. Transponder Key Services

    • Transponder keys are geared up with a chip that communicates with your car's computer.
    • A locksmith can cut and program a brand-new transponder key if the initial is lost or damaged.
  6. High-Security Key Replacement

    • Some high-end cars use high-security keys that are harder to replicate.
    • A locksmith can replace these keys, making sure that they fulfill the high standards of security required by your vehicle.
  7. Lost or Stolen Key Replacement

    • If your keys are lost or stolen, a locksmith can provide a new set of keys and, if necessary, reprogram the car's security system to prevent unauthorized access.

FAQs About Locksmith Car Key Services

Q: How long does it take for a locksmith to show up?

  • A: The response time can differ depending on the locksmith's availability and your location. Most respectable locksmith professionals aim to get here within 30 minutes to an hour.

Q: Are locksmith professionals pricey?

  • A: The expense of a locksmith service can differ, however it is typically much more affordable than going through a dealership. Aspects that affect the rate consist of the type of service, the complexity of the key, and the locksmith's location.

Q: Can a locksmith make a key without the original?

  • A: Yes, a locksmith can make a new key without the original, however the process may be more intricate and costly. They will require the vehicle's VIN (Vehicle Identification Number) and might require you to provide proof of ownership.

Q: Are locksmith professionals able to bypass car alarms?

  • A: Reputable locksmiths are trained to manage car alarms and security systems. They can typically disable or bypass the alarm to access to your vehicle safely.

Q: Is it safe to use a locksmith?

  • A: Yes, as long as you pick a certified and insured locksmith. They learn experts who follow rigorous ethical standards to guarantee your security and the security of your vehicle.

Q: What should I do if I lose my car keys and don't have a spare?

  • A: If you do not have a spare key, call a locksmith right away. They can provide a brand-new key and, if required, reprogram the car's security system to prevent unapproved access.
